Fertilization is essential for promoting healthy plant growth, vibrant foliage, and robust root systems. A balanced supply of nutrients-- mainly nitrogen, phosphorus, and potassium-- is required to support different plant functions, from leaf development to flowering and tension tolerance. Soil screening assists identify particular deficiencies and guide fertilization techniques. Fertilizer application can be granular, liquid, slow-release, or natural, depending upon plant needs, soil conditions, and ecological considerations. Timing and dose are critical to avoid over-fertilization, nutrient overflow, or plant damage. Seasonal scheduling makes sure plants receive nutrients when they are most required, supporting peak development durations. Regular fertilization enhances plant durability against bugs, diseases, and ecological stress factors. A well-nourished landscape keeps visual appeal and long-term health, optimizing the return on maintenance efforts
